오픈소스 기여로 경력 쌓는 법



포트폴리오 강화와 실무 경험을 동시에 얻는 전략



많은 개발자들이 '경력을 어떻게 쌓을까' 고민합니다. 그 중에서도 오픈소스 기여는 실제 현업 수준의 협업 경험을 얻고, 실력 있는 개발자들과 네트워크를 형성하며 자연스럽게 포트폴리오를 강화할 수 있는 최적의 방법입니다. 단순히 소스코드를 수정하는 것을 넘어 이슈 리포팅, 문서 보완, 리뷰 피드백 등 다양한 방식으로 기여가 가능하며, 꾸준한 활동은 신뢰 있는 경력의 증거로 작용합니다. 본 글에서는 오픈소스에 처음 입문하는 분들을 위한 기여 시작 단계부터 실제 경력으로 연결하는 전략까지 구체적인 가이드를 안내드립니다. 실무 경력이 부족하거나, 이력서에 강력한 무기를 추가하고 싶은 개발자라면 반드시 알아야 할 오픈소스의 세계를 함께 살펴보세요.




기여 방식 코드 수정, 이슈 작성, 문서 개선 등 다양함
초보자 추천 good first issue 라벨이 달린 이슈부터 시작

오픈소스 기여는 단순히 유명 프로젝트에 코드를 올리는 것이 아닙니다. 작은 문서 수정이나 오류 보고도 모두 소중한 기여이며, 처음에는 이슈 리포트나 README 개선 등으로 시작해도 충분합니다. 프로젝트의 구조를 파악하고, 어떤 기여가 필요한지를 이해하는 것이 우선입니다. 기여자 가이드를 읽고 로컬에서 실행해보며 개발 환경 세팅부터 경험해보는 과정 자체가 큰 학습이 됩니다.



두 번째로 중요한 것은 커뮤니케이션입니다. 대부분의 오픈소스 프로젝트는 GitHub를 기반으로 운영되며, 이슈에 댓글을 달거나 PR에 대한 피드백을 받는 과정에서 자연스럽게 전 세계 개발자들과 협업하게 됩니다. 영어가 완벽하지 않아도 구조적이고 예의 있는 소통이 더 중요하며, 이렇게 쌓은 경험은 커뮤니케이션 능력의 큰 자산이 됩니다.




Key Points

꾸준한 기여는 신뢰로 이어지고, 일정 기간 이상 기여를 이어가면 프로젝트의 Maintainer로 초대받을 수도 있습니다. 이는 채용 과정에서 기술력 + 리더십 + 협업능력을 증명하는 강력한 경력 요소가 됩니다. 이력서와 포트폴리오에 구체적인 활동 내역과 링크를 포함시키면 실무 경험 이상의 평가를 받을 수 있습니다.



초보자 기여 커뮤니케이션 경력화 전략
good first issue, 문서 수정, 작은 이슈 대응 깃허브에서 PR 피드백, 이슈 토론 참여 포트폴리오, 이력서 링크 및 활동 정리
프로젝트 구조 학습 병행 논리적이고 예의 있는 댓글 작성 지속적 활동으로 Maintainer 승격 가능


처음 기여할 오픈소스는 어떻게 찾나요?

GitHub에서 ‘good first issue’ 라벨이 있는 프로젝트나 자신이 사용 중인 라이브러리부터 살펴보면 접근이 쉽습니다.



영어가 약한데 괜찮을까요?

전문 영어가 아닌 간단한 문장 중심으로 작성하면 충분하며, 문법보다도 논리적이고 친절한 태도가 더 중요합니다.



 

기여 기록은 어떻게 활용하나요?

GitHub 프로필 링크를 포트폴리오에 넣고, 주요 기여 내역은 README나 이력서에 별도로 정리해 활용합니다.

오픈소스는 단순한 개발 참여를 넘어서 나만의 경력을 스스로 만들어가는 과정입니다. 기여를 통해 성장한 기록은 이력서보다 강력한 증거가 되며, 협업과 커뮤니케이션, 문제 해결 능력을 자연스럽게 갖추게 됩니다. 오늘부터 작은 한 줄의 코드, 하나의 이슈 참여부터 시작해보세요. 그 모든 것이 여러분의 실력이자 커리어가 됩니다.

 

여러분의 기여 경험을 들려주세요!

어떤 오픈소스에 참여하셨나요? 초보자로서 시작했던 경험이나, 기억에 남는 PR이 있다면 댓글로 공유해 주세요. 많은 분들에게 큰 도움이 됩니다.